San Ysidro Border Crossing
The San Ysidro border crossing is a massive operation. It handles tens of thousands of vehicles and pedestrians daily. The volume of traffic means that wait times can be substantial, sometimes exceeding several hours during peak periods. Tijuana border crossing news today might include alerts about increased security measures or temporary lane closures that can further impact wait times. To navigate the San Ysidro crossing effectively, it’s advisable to: Check wait times: Use the CBP website or mobile apps to get real-time estimates. Consider non-peak hours: Crossing during off-peak times (e.g., early mornings or late evenings) can significantly reduce your wait. Utilize SENTRI/Ready Lane: If you're eligible, use dedicated lanes for faster processing. Be prepared: Have all your documents ready, and be patient. The San Ysidro port of entry is also a major hub for pedestrians. The pedestrian crossing is often very busy, with long lines, especially during holidays or weekends. The pedestrian lanes are separate from vehicle lanes, but they also experience congestion. The latest Tijuana border crossing news today will often include updates on any pedestrian-specific delays or closures. Be prepared for a wait and wear comfortable shoes! The San Ysidro crossing is also closely monitored by both US and Mexican authorities, so expect thorough checks. Have your documents ready to show. Otay Mesa Border Crossing
The Otay Mesa border crossing is the second-busiest port of entry, and it caters to both commercial and passenger vehicles. While it often has shorter wait times than San Ysidro, it's still subject to congestion, particularly during the morning and afternoon commute hours. Tijuana border crossing news today might highlight specific times when Otay Mesa experiences peak traffic. Some key tips for crossing at Otay Mesa include: Monitoring wait times: The CBP website and mobile apps provide real-time updates. Considering the time of day: Plan your crossing to avoid peak commute hours. Using Ready Lane/SENTRI: If eligible, utilize the dedicated lanes. Having all documents ready: Ensure you have your passport, visa (if required), and any other necessary documentation. The Otay Mesa border crossing also has a dedicated lane for commercial vehicles, which is crucial for trade and business. The latest news might address any changes in procedures or infrastructure improvements at this crossing. It’s also crucial to remember that wait times at Otay Mesa can be affected by various factors, including the volume of traffic, security checks, and even weather conditions. Documents and Identification
Having the right documents is non-negotiable for a successful border crossing. Required documents include: A valid passport: Always ensure your passport is valid for at least six months beyond your intended stay. A visa (if required): Check visa requirements based on your nationality and the purpose of your trip. Other forms of identification: Be prepared to show your driver's license or other forms of identification. If you're a SENTRI or Global Entry member, make sure your card is valid and readily available. Tijuana border crossing news today will always highlight any new requirements or changes to the accepted documents. Always double-check your documents before your trip. Keep all your documents organized and easily accessible. Tijuana border crossing delays can easily occur if you do not have the proper documentation. When crossing with children, you will need to: Provide proof of relationship (birth certificate or passport). Have any necessary consent letters from the other parent if the child is traveling with only one parent. Prohibited Items and Restrictions
Understanding what you can and cannot bring across the border is vital to avoid issues. There are restrictions on certain items, so it's essential to be informed. Prohibited items include illegal drugs and weapons: Strict enforcement of these restrictions. Certain food items: Restrictions on importing fruits, vegetables, and other agricultural products. Large amounts of currency: You must declare amounts over $10,000. Alcohol and tobacco: There are limits on the amount you can bring. Tijuana border crossing news today often includes reminders about prohibited items, especially during holiday seasons. Declare all items and be truthful with customs officials. Ignoring these rules can lead to significant penalties, including fines, seizure of items, or even detention. Being aware of these restrictions will help ensure a smooth crossing.
